We will leave Punta del Este at the agreed time to enjoy a different day, touring routes, local roads and sand dunes.
We leave for La Pedrera, where we will stop to enjoy a drink, while we admire and photograph the beauties of its beaches.
We will continue along the route until we reach the Cabo terminal, to leave our conventional vehicle and start traveling in 4x4 the sandy roads that lead us to Cabo Polonio, with its varied landscapes, sand dunes, tame and wild beaches, animals of sea and countryside, artisans and a very unique color. relax, fun, walks, all in one place and of course, time to delight us with some gastronomic specialties.
Time for the beach and return, again on the road, we go to La Paloma, we take a short walk to see a different spa, culminating in the sunset over the ocean beaches.
At the end of this tour, we will be back in Punta del Este.
